Rispecchi
Rispecchi is the plural form of rispecchio, an archaic Italian noun that historically denotes a mirror or a reflective surface. In contemporary Italian, the everyday term for a mirror is specchio, and rispecchio is typically found only in historical texts, philological discussions, or literary quotations. As a noun, rispecchi can appear in poetry or prose to convey the idea of likeness, reflection, or truth, often in metaphorical or symbolic contexts.
